The Experience Cloud site manager of Cloud Kicks has enabled reputation for its community members, As per the recommendation given by the Experience Cloud consultant, a decision was made to use the out of the box features.
Which two things happen automatically when the site manager enables automation? Choose 2 answers
- Customer portal members gain the ability to provide badges to other members.
- Inactive and active members are assigned default reputation points.
- Chatter influence is removed from the Contribution section on the Profile page.
- Default point system and set of reputation levels become available.
Answer(s): B,D
Explanation:
Reputation is a feature that allows you to reward community members for their contributions and engagement.
When you enable reputation for your community, some things happen automatically, such as:
Inactive and active members are assigned default reputation points. Inactive members get zero points, while active members get 10 points.
Default point system and set of reputation levels become available. You can use the default point system or customize it to suit your needs. You can also use the default reputation levels or create your own.
